Quick Assessment

This biography introduces young readers to Leonardo da Vinci, highlighting his contributions as an artist, scientist, and inventor during the Renaissance. Designed for ages 13-18, the book includes vocabulary support, educational videos, and research projects to deepen understanding and engagement. It is a comprehensive nonfiction resource suitable for students interested in art, science, and history.
